Abraham van Cuylenborch (Utrecht 1610–1658)
![Abraham van Cuylenborch (Utrecht 1610–1658) - Old Master Paintings Abraham van Cuylenborch (Utrecht 1610–1658) - Old Master Paintings](/fileadmin/lot-images/38A121017/normal/abraham-van-cuylenborch-utrecht-1610-1658-4560085.jpg)
A grotto with travellers and a sculpture of Bacchus, signed and dated 164(8)?, oil on canvas, 71.5 x 67 cm, framed
In 17th-century Dutch inventories, this painting is always described as a grotje or grotto, which shows its popularity as an independent motif. Cuylenborch was already enjoying great success with such pictures amongst contemporary critics and collectors. A preference for imaginary views was the most striking characteristic of Utrecht landscape painting in the 1st half of the 17th century. In other parts of the region, artists concentrated on Dutch landscapes or city vedute. Cuylenborch’s oeuvre consists largely of such grotjes. Aside from him, only Dirk Stoop and Carel de Hooch were producing comparable cave pictures in Utrecht. Outside Utrecht, his only competitor was the Amsterdam painter, Rombout van Troyen. Works by Cuylenborch are dated between 1642 and 1648.
